what is the up limit of a CF card can be used on A70

I wanna enhance the memory size of CF card so may I take any CF card suchs as 1 or 2 GB of a different brand

Yes, the A70 will accept up to 2GB CF cards. Stick with Canon, Lexar or Kingston. You should be able to get a 100x or better speed card for a good price these days.
